- Essential Functions:
- Collaborate with FCS team to label and assemble clinical supplies accurately, ensuring precise label placement and documentation.
- Accurately count out and prepare packaging supplies to ensure accurate accountabilities prior to and at the completion of a job order.
- Assist Quality Assurance personnel, Production Supervisors, and Line Leaders in staging and reconciliation of components as required.
- Perform manual and automated filling and bottling of pharmaceutical products independently and approve in-process products at other stations.
- Review batch paperwork and follow supervisor instructions to understand and perform the necessary packaging procedures required for assembly of each study.
- Start, stop, and operate packaging machinery that fills, wraps, labels, or packs pharmaceutical products.
- High school diploma or equivalent experience required.
- Ability to read, write, and complete basic mathematics calculations.
- Hand-eye coordination, manual and finger dexterity, mindfulness, and the ability to do repetitive tasks and learn new ones with assistance from supervisors and fellow workers.
- Dexterity and ability to perform various manufacturing/packaging operations.
- Extended periods of standing while working in rooms.
- Exerting up to 25 lbs. of force occasionally and/or 10 to 25 lbs. of force frequently to move objects.
- Able to wear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) such as respirators and protective eyewear as required.
- Allergies to specific drugs may disqualify individuals from performing these duties.
- Requires Near Vision Acuity of at least 20/40 with corrected vision. Must have color vision and adjust focus.
